About the Instructor - Ava Holmes
Former Ithacan has spent the past 7 years studying cacao and living in the lower Peruvian Amazon. Her journey with cacao started with a profound love for nature and desire to help heal cacao’s relationship with the earth (chocolate is one of the leading causing of agricultural deforestation in cacao-fertil lands such as Peru). This lead her to open a center of investigation surrounding cacao and it’s many socio-environmental influences, both ancient and modern—including what she calls a “mesmerizing” and deep dive into cacao’s therapeutic and medicinal uses today.
